Output 3965c06b5e5c42dbb85f48051f59a8bcee3b3866de83b01b2e8ff351eda4248d:1

value
37059914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5440074dd0821a17310d0456e143455e363ab569 OP_EQUAL
address
MFadhKm7x1jojudjNV5cJBpUhm7rriwM7h
transaction
3965c06b5e5c42dbb85f48051f59a8bcee3b3866de83b01b2e8ff351eda4248d
spent
true